How they compare

Madagascar currently reports 16.2% against 16.0% in Argentina, a difference of 0.2%.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 56 shared years of data; in 1962 it was Madagascar ahead.

Argentina ranks 157th and Madagascar ranks 155th of 187 countries.

Across the 6 decades both report, Argentina averaged higher in 5 and Madagascar in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Argentina Madagascar Difference Ahead
1960s 12.0% 14.4% 2.4% Madagascar
1970s 18.2% 15.2% 3.0% Argentina
1980s 26.2% 13.2% 13.0% Argentina
1990s 19.3% 10.7% 8.6% Argentina
2000s 14.1% 8.3% 5.8% Argentina
2010s 14.4% 11.4% 3.1% Argentina

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Domestic credit to private sector refers to financial resources provided to the private sector, such as through loans, purchases of nonequity securities, and trade credits and other accounts receivable, that establish a claim for repayment. For some countries these claims include credit to public enterprises.
